Well, the pickle ornament story is really interesting. Legend has it that it originated in Germany. It was a symbol of good luck. Families would hide the pickle ornament deep within the branches of the Christmas tree. Kids would search for it on Christmas morning, and the one who found it was considered lucky for the upcoming year.

The pickle Christmas tree ornament has an interesting backstory. There are tales that it was used as a way to test children's attentiveness. In some families, the pickle ornament was hidden so well that it took a sharp eye to spot it. This added an extra layer of fun to the Christmas morning routine. It's not just an ornament but a piece of a cultural and family - centered Christmas tradition. Over time, it has become a beloved part of Christmas in many places around the world, representing both the fun and the traditions that are passed down through generations.
